The three main files I backed up that worked for me:

1) eqhost.txt - Tells the game what login server IP to use.
2) eqgame.exe - Game executable.
3) eqgfx_dx8.dll - Game's main graphics DLL.

Just backing up those files before an EQLive patch managed to let me log back into EQEmu afterwards, however there were a few bugs related to spells and abilities. So I also suggest backing up the additional files:

4) eqstr_en.txt - Contains plain text strings the game uses for generic english messages.
5) spells_en.txt - Contains english spell data.
